I don't really know of a good _simple_ explanation of eddy current
brakes. Although the mechanism by which they work is somewhat
intuitive, the mathematical description of them can be nontrivial.

Anyhow, I like to think of eddy current brakes as being like induction
motors--you could get a lot of insight into eddy current brakes by
thinking of them in that way. An eddy current brake would be the
special case of an induction motor in which the applied frequency is
zero (i.e. DC currents are flowing in the windings of the machine).

I also had some note that I wrote a while ago "for fun" that describes
how one would obtain a closed-form expression for the force produced
by a particular configuration of linear eddy current brake. Since the
answers are analytical, it may be possible to glean some intuitive
insight about what's going on, although it's still pretty
mathematical... I've put a copy of this at: 
http://groups.yahoo.com/group/femm/files/halb.pdf
This note is somewhat similiar to the recent paper:
Spok-Myeong Jang, Sung-Ho Lee, and Sang-Sub Jeong, "Characteristic
analysis of eddy-current brake system using the linear Halbach array",
IEEE Transactions on Magnetics, 38(5):2994-2996, September 2002.
